What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few specific variables. First, the size of your tank and the total volume of waste removal play a role. We also look at the accessibility of your tank lids; if they are buried deep underground or hidden under landscaping, extra labor is required to reach them. The distance from our truck to the tank also impacts the setup time. Every property has unique plumbing needs, and ex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

About this service

Septic cleaning involves a comprehensive inspection and removal of the accumulated solids from your tank. Over time, layers of scum and sludge build up, and if not removed, they can clog your drain field. You generally need this service every few years, depending on your tank size and water usage. Regular cleaning prevents messy backups and ensures your system continues to treat wastewater effectively, keeping your plumbing running smoothly and protecting your local groundwater.

What is a septic distribution box and its role in Lafayette?

A septic distribution box, or D-box, is a crucial component in many Lafayette septic systems. It receives wastewater from the septic tank and evenly distributes it to the drain field trenches. This ensures effluent is spread out for proper treatment by the soil. If the D-box is clogged or damaged, it can lead to uneven distribution and drain field failure. Pros can inspect and service this component.

What are signs of a failing septic tank drain field in Lafayette?

Signs of a failing septic tank drain field in Lafayette include persistent soggy or wet areas in your yard, even without rain. Foul odors near the drain field are also a strong indicator. If your toilets or drains are backing up, it could mean the drain field is overwhelmed or clogged. Early detection by licensed pros is crucial to prevent more extensive and costly damage to your property.
